How to Build a WooCommerce Subscription Reminder Email on WordPress Business Sites?


In the competitive world of e-commerce, businesses are continually seeking innovative strategies to retain customers and drive consistent revenue. One effective method is by offering subscription-based products or services. WooCommerce, a popular WordPress plugin, provides an excellent platform for businesses to implement subscription models easily.

To complement this setup, businesses can create WooCommerce subscription reminder emails to engage customers, reduce churn, and enhance their overall shopping experience. In this article, we'll explore step-by-step guidelines on how to build a WooCommerce subscription reminder email on WordPress business sites.

Install and Set Up WooCommerce Plugin

Before diving into creating subscription reminders, ensure that you have the WooCommerce plugin installed and activated on your WordPress business site. WooCommerce offers a comprehensive and user-friendly platform to manage subscriptions, making it ideal for businesses of all sizes.

To get started, navigate to your WordPress dashboard, click on “Plugins,” and then select “Add New.” Search for “WooCommerce,” click on the “Install Now” button, and finally, click “Activate” once the installation is complete.

Install a Suitable Email Marketing Plugin

To automate subscription reminders, integrate an email marketing plugin with WooCommerce. Numerous plugins offer this functionality, such as Mailchimp, Sendinblue, or HubSpot. Choose one that aligns with your business requirements, install it, and connect it to your WooCommerce store.

Once you’ve selected an email marketing plugin, install it by going to the “Plugins” section in your WordPress dashboard and selecting “Add New.” Search for the chosen plugin, click on “Install Now,” and then activate it once the installation is complete. Follow the plugin’s setup wizard to connect it to your WooCommerce store and configure your email settings.

Define Subscription Reminder Triggers

Decide when you want to send out subscription reminders. Some common triggers include:

  1. a) Pre-Expiration Reminder: Send an email a few days before the subscription expires, encouraging customers to renew.
  2. b) Post-Expiration Reminder: Send follow-up emails after a subscription has lapsed to re-engage customers.
  3. c) Upcoming Billing Reminder: Notify customers about an upcoming billing cycle to ensure their payment details are up-to-date.
  4. d) Cross-Sell/Upsell Reminder: Recommend related products or upgrades to encourage customers to extend their subscriptions.

Each of these triggers serves a specific purpose in keeping your customers engaged and encouraging them to maintain their subscriptions. You can set up these triggers within your chosen email marketing plugin’s automation or campaign settings.

Craft Compelling Email Content

The content of your subscription reminder email plays a crucial role in its effectiveness. Here are some essential tips:

  1. a) Personalization: Address the recipient by name to establish a personal connection. 
  2. b) Clear and Concise Messaging: Keep the email content straightforward and easy to understand. Avoid lengthy paragraphs and use bullet points to communicate important information.
  c) Value Proposition: Highlight the benefits of maintaining their subscription and how it adds value to their lives. Let them know about exclusive features, discounts, or access to premium content they'll continue to enjoy.
  4. d) Call to Action: Include a prominent and compelling call-to-action (CTA) button that directs customers to renew or upgrade their subscriptions. Make sure the CTA stands out visually and uses action-oriented language like “Renew Now” or “Upgrade Today.”

Set Up Automated Email Campaigns

With your email marketing plugin integrated and content prepared, set up automated email campaigns for each reminder trigger. Most plugins allow you to schedule and automate these emails based on specific events or intervals.

In your email marketing plugin, create a new campaign or automation sequence for each reminder trigger. Define the trigger condition, such as "X days before subscription expiration" or "X days after subscription expiration." Customize the email content to align with the specific reminder trigger and schedule the emails to be sent automatically.

Test and Optimize

Before launching your subscription reminder email campaign, perform thorough testing to ensure everything works as expected. Test different email subject lines, content variations, and CTA buttons to optimize the email’s performance.

Send test emails to yourself and your colleagues to review the layout, content, and functionality. Check the emails across various devices, including desktop, mobile, and tablets, to ensure they are responsive and visually appealing.

Monitor and Analyze Results

Once your WooCommerce subscription reminder email campaign is active, closely monitor its performance. Pay attention to open rates, click-through rates (CTRs), and conversion rates. Analyze the data to identify areas for improvement and make necessary adjustments to boost the campaign's effectiveness.

Most email marketing plugins provide detailed analytics and reports to help you track the performance of your campaigns. Use this data to make informed decisions and optimize your email content, timing, and triggers.


Implementing a WooCommerce subscription reminder email campaign can significantly impact customer retention and boost recurring revenue for your WordPress business site. By leveraging the power of email marketing and automation, businesses can engage customers, encourage subscription renewals, and foster lasting relationships.

Remember, the key to success lies in crafting compelling content, defining appropriate triggers, and regularly optimizing your campaigns based on data-driven insights. So, take advantage of the WooCommerce ecosystem, and start building your subscription reminder email campaign to secure a prosperous future for your business.

